Understanding Validation and Qualification

While often used interchangeably, qualification and validation have distinct meanings. Specifically, qualification typically refers to the assessment of equipment, utilities, and systems, while validation focuses on processes. In essence, qualification is an integral part of the larger validation process.

GMP/GLP Requirements

Complying with GMP and GLP ensures equipment accuracy, product safety, and efficacy. To this end, guidelines such as USP, ICH, FDA, ASTM, and ISPE Baseline Guides recommend a risk-based approach, focusing on the most critical aspects of equipment.

Steps for Successful Validation

The validation process involves three qualifications:

  1. Installation Qualification (IQ): Ensures equipment is installed per manufacturer’s specifications.
  2. Operational Qualification (OQ): Verifies equipment operates according to those specifications.
  3. Performance Qualification (PQ): Confirms equipment performs consistently and reproducibly over time.

Accurate documentation and personnel training are vital throughout these steps.

Tips for Streamlining Your Validation Process

  1. Risk-Based Approach: Above all, focus on critical aspects, minimizing unnecessary steps to save time and money.
  2. Planning: Additionally, create a detailed schedule, allocate resources, and use a standardized approach (like SOPs or a validated master plan).
  3. Technology: Embrace automated testing equipment, data analysis software, and electronic documentation systems.
  4. Clear Roles: To ensure smooth execution, assign responsibilities clearly to minimize delays and ensure everyone understands their tasks.
  5. Continuous Review: Lastly, regularly evaluate the process to identify and address areas for improvement.
